How Long Will It Take to Build My Custom Home?
Understanding the timeline is crucial when planning your dream home. Custom home construction often takes longer than standard builds due to the level of personalization and local considerations involved. On average, the process can take at least a year and often longer, depending on the complexity of the design and materials used.
Ask your builder to outline the construction stages—from design to final inspection—and how they plan to address potential delays. In areas like Martin and Northern Palm Beach Counties, where weather can occasionally disrupt construction, it’s important to understand contingency plans. Are There Hidden Costs to Consider?
Transparency is critical in budgeting for a custom home. While the initial estimate may cover most expenses, additional costs like site preparation and landscaping are common. These can vary based on your location—in places such as Stuart and Jupiter, they may require specific permits or site adjustments, especially for waterfront homes compared to other areas.

What Sustainable Building Practices Are Available?
Sustainability is an important consideration in modern home construction. Builders should offer eco-friendly options like sustainable materials, water conservation systems, and efficient insulation.
Explore their certifications, such as L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design), and their experience with green building practices. Features like eco-friendly flooring, non-toxic paints, and rainwater harvesting can enhance your home’s efficiency and value. For waterfront projects, ask about strategies to minimize environmental impact, like native landscaping or erosion prevention measures.
